Output ec856c5b67fd6474e6cb9f7d5f718dfc4f06bbfccc2030b3c066ea16f9948f87:6

value
2984625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4075607a628ac9a3fa680bca1edef43851200a OP_EQUAL
address
3A6oJr7BwodRVyMxRwoo4wAiYGPX3xnikq
transaction
ec856c5b67fd6474e6cb9f7d5f718dfc4f06bbfccc2030b3c066ea16f9948f87
spent
true